About N-[1-(3-amino-3-oxopropyl)-5-[benzoyl(methyl)amino]benzimidazol-2-yl]-5-[(E)-2-(3-nitrophenyl)ethenyl]thiophene-2-carboxamide
N-[1-(3-amino-3-oxopropyl)-5-[benzoyl(methyl)amino]benzimidazol-2-yl]-5-[(E)-2-(3-nitrophenyl)ethenyl]thiophene-2-carboxamide (PubChem CID 25190561) has the molecular formula C31H26N6O5S
and a molecular weight of 594.65 g/mol. Its IUPAC name is N-[1-(3-amino-3-oxopropyl)-5-[benzoyl(methyl)amino]benzimidazol-2-yl]-5-[(E)-2-(3-nitrophenyl)ethenyl]thiophene-2-carboxamide.
